Why Product Photography Matters More Than You Think

When someone shops online, they can’t touch your product. They can’t feel the texture, test the weight, or see the color in real life. All they have to go on is your product photo—and that photo needs to do a lot of heavy lifting. High-quality photography builds trust, tells a story, and highlights the value of your product. On the flip side, poor photography sends a different message: “This brand doesn’t care.”

Mistake #1: Lighting That’s Just… Sad

If your photos are dim, shadowy, or yellow-toned, you’re not putting your products in their best light (literally). Natural lighting is your best friend. Snap pics near a window or outside during the golden hour. If you’re shooting indoors, use soft, white lighting and avoid overhead fluorescents. A small lightbox or ring light can work wonders.

 

Mistake #2: Busy Backgrounds That Distract

Your product should be the star, not the clutter in the background. Use a clean, neutral backdrop to help your item pop. Plain white works great, but if your brand is bold and colorful, you can play with backgrounds that match your vibe—as long as they don’t steal the spotlight.

 

Mistake #3: Blurry or Low-Quality Images

This one’s a dealbreaker. Blurry or pixelated photos scream unprofessional. Even if you’re using a smartphone, you can still take crisp, high-res images. Use a tripod or steady surface, and tap to focus before snapping. Then, take a few extra minutes to edit. Brighten, sharpen, crop. It’s worth it.

 

Mistake #4: Not Showing Multiple Angles or Uses

A single front-facing shot doesn’t cut it anymore. Customers want to see your product from every angle—front, back, side, and even in use. If it’s wearable, show it on a model. If it’s a product that solves a problem, show it in action. Help your customers visualize it in their lives.

 

Mistake #5: Forgetting Brand Consistency

Does your product page look like five different people took five different photos? Inconsistent lighting, styling, or sizing can confuse customers and cheapen your brand. Create a simple style guide: same lighting, same angles, same vibe across all product photos. It helps build trust—and makes your store look way more pro.
